Tom-the-eagle Flag Croydon 14 Aug 17 5.50pm

Who do you think was better?

Similar kind of players, both tall target men.

According to Wikepdia their Palace goal scoring record is:

Bright: Played 227 - scored 91
Benteke: Played 37 - scored 15

Similar records although most of Brights were in the second tier.

Benteke commanded the big fee and is an international unlike Bright however Bright played for us during our most successful period by far.
I imagine Bright also made a lot more assists (to Wrighty).

Personally I think this is a close one however (and it maybe through rose tinted glasses) I would probably edge Bright.
